Therapeutic approaches and how they work online

Acceptance and Commitment Therapy, or ACT, helps people notice difficult thoughts and feelings without getting stuck in them. It focuses on identifying what matters most and taking small steps toward those values. Cognitive Behavioral Therapy, or CBT, targets the thoughts and behaviors that keep problems going by teaching practical skills and short exercises to try between sessions.

Choosing an approach is a team effort. The therapist will talk with each person about goals, preferences, and the problems they want to solve. Together they decide whether ACT, CBT, DBT techniques, or trauma-focused work is the best fit and adjust the plan as progress unfolds.

Online sessions use video calls, phone sessions, live chat, or text-based messaging to make therapy more flexible. Video is useful for deeper conversations and skill practice. Phone sessions can work when bandwidth is limited or a simpler check-in is needed. Live chat and text messaging let people share thoughts between meetings and fit brief check-ins into a busy day. These options help people keep momentum and make therapy easier to fit into real life.
